In recent literature, a general theory has been developed to design low-sensitivity digital filter structures in the

-domain. These structures are two-ports with two inputs and two outputs and wave digital filters belong to this general class. This paper explores the significance of the para-unitary or complementary condition on generalized wave digital filters. Satisfying this condition allows, for example, the simultaneous generation of low- and high-pass filter outputs. There is discussion too of sensitivity and its significance to those generalized wave digital filter structures that do not satisfy the para-unitary condition.
